About Damian Klóska
Damian Klóska is a scholar working on Aging, Immunology and Molecular Biology, having authored 28 papers that have together received 697 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Genomics, phytochemicals, and oxidative stress (10 papers), Heme Oxygenase-1 and Carbon Monoxide (5 papers), Aortic aneurysm repair treatments (4 papers), Glutathione Transferases and Polymorphisms (3 papers), ATP Synthase and ATPases Research (2 papers), Neonatal Health and Biochemistry (2 papers), IL-33, ST2, and ILC Pathways (2 papers) and Eicosanoids and Hypertension Pharmacology (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Molecular Biology (430 citations), Aging (10 citations) and Critical Care and Intensive Care Medicine (23 citations). Damian Klóska has collaborated with scholars based in Poland, Austria and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Anna Grochot‐Przeczek, Aleksandra Kopacz, Alicja Józkowicz, Henry Jay Forman, Aleksandra Piechota-Polańczyk, Józef Dulak, Antonio Cuadrado, Marta Targosz‐Korecka, Arno R. Bourgonje and Harry van Goor.
